Charges and bets: a general characterisation of common priors

Author

Listed:
  • Ziv Hellman

    (Bar-Ilan University)

  • Miklós Pintér

    (Corvinus University of Budapest)

Abstract

We show that the equivalence of common priors and absence of agreeable bets of the famous no betting theorem can be generalised to any infinite space (not only compact spaces) if we expand the set of priors to include probability charges as priors. Going beyond the strict prior/no common prior dichotomy, we further uncover a fine-grained decomposition of the class of type spaces into a continuum of subclasses in each of which an epistemic condition approximating common priors is equivalent to a behavioural condition limiting acceptable bets.
